Literature Review,itute for conventional diesel fuel. Biodiesel refers to the lower alkyl esters of long chain fatty acids, which are synthesized either by transesterification with lower alcohols or by esterification of fatty acids in the presence or absence of a catalyst (Freedman & Pryde, 1984).

Production of Biodiesel Using Spherical Millimetric Catalyst,tassium iodide (KI), potassium fluoride (KF), and sodium nitrate (NaNO.) catalysts for the production of biodiesel from palm oil at 60 °C in batch process. The catalysts were prepared at different loading contents, and the effects of these catalysts on the transesterification reaction were evaluated
